Lines: 15 Lines is rather useful. I may be willing to read 30 lines of ranting on a subject that I'm not about to read 300 lines on. "Size" doesn't convey quite the same info. Lines maps fairly well to "screens", whereas "size" doesn't give me any idea how many screens of junk I have to wade thru. As for Organization, it has often been the only way I could figure out where a poster was (short of grepping the maps files).
